PineRose from Twenty20 Mendocino is an F1 photoperiod hybrid crafted by pairing Ave (Avenue of The Giants) #33 with Strawberry Lemonade #R14. What began as an experimental cross quickly earned a spot in the catalog after test runs revealed an unmistakable perfume: vivid pine needles intertwined with soft, candied rose. Indoors, PineRose finishes in 60–65 days; outdoors it reaches the early-October harvest window. Plants show above‑average stretch yet ask for only below‑average trellising, building long, tidy colas and an average yield per square foot. Nearly every phenotype leans into the namesake profile, translating on the palate as crisp pine, sugared rose, and a gentle sweetness that lingers on the exhale. Growers will note a consistent, well‑structured habit, reflective of Twenty20’s selection work and the line’s Above Average PVI. While cannabinoid numbers are batch‑dependent, PineRose expresses a resinous, floral‑forward character aimed squarely at connoisseurs of botanical terpenes. Credit where due: Twenty20 Mendocino’s Ave lineage adds backbone and structure, while Strawberry Lemonade #R14 supplies bright top‑notes and charm. For cultivators seeking a distinctive aroma without finicky support needs, PineRose offers a fresh, modern profile anchored to a practical 8½–9½â€‘week finish and a dependable, medium output—balanced genetics, thoughtfully executed. Expect dense, lime‑to‑olive flowers dusted in sparkling trichomes and a clean, garden‑fresh finish.
